LINSEED OIL.

[Per Press Association.]

WELLINGTON, December 12. Tho Hon A. M. Myers has been ad« vised by the High Commissioner that he is unablo to secure at present the release of any quantity of linseed oil for export from tho United Kingdom. As far ns tho High Commissioner can judge, the situation with regard .to supplies of linseed oil is unlikely to improve in the United Kingdom, therefore the suggestion is made tnat possibly New Zealand merchants can se-l euro supplies from India or America, ; where, it is believed, stocks may bo ■ held. Mr Divers says that in tile event \ of merchants making a purchase from i either of those countries, he, as Min- i ister in charge of Munitions and Sup- T plies, will bo pleased to assist ns far i as possible in obtaining release and ; shipment if necessary. , !
